.exportaciones-giro {
    background-color: transparent;
}

.exportaciones-giro__layout {
    align-items: center;
    gap: 1.5rem;
}

.exportaciones-giro__imagen {
    display: flex;
    justify-content: center;
}

.exportaciones-giro__imagen img {
    width: 100%;
    max-width: 820px;
    height: auto;
    display: block;
}

.exportaciones-giro__contenido {
    width: 100%;
}

.exportaciones-giro__title {
    margin: 0 0 1rem;
    color: var(--color-primary);
    text-transform: uppercase;
    line-height: 0.95;
}

.exportaciones-giro__cards {
    gap: 1rem;
}

.exportaciones-giro__card {
    flex: 1 1 calc(50% - 0.5rem);
    min-width: 250px;
    background: var(--color-primary-hover);
    padding: clamp(1.2rem, 2vw, 1.8rem);
    color: var(--color-white);
    text-align: center;
    display: flex;
    flex-direction: column;
    align-items: center;
    justify-content: center;
    min-height: 210px;
    transform: scale(1);
    transition: background-color 0.4s ease-in-out, transform 0.3s ease-in-out;
}

.exportaciones-giro__card:hover{
    background-color: var(--color-success);
    transform: scale(1.02);
}

.exportaciones-giro__icon {
    width: 58px;
    height: 58px;
    margin-bottom: 0.55rem;
}

.exportaciones-giro__icon svg {
    width: 100%;
    height: 100%;
    fill: none;
    stroke: #ffffff;
    stroke-width: 1.8;
    stroke-linecap: round;
    stroke-linejoin: round;
}

.exportaciones-giro__card-title {
    margin: 0;
    color: var(--color-white);
    font-size: clamp(1.6rem, 2vw, 2.2rem);
    line-height: 1;
}

.exportaciones-giro__card-copy {
    margin: 0.7rem 0 0;
    color: var(--color-white);
    font-size: clamp(0.95rem, 1.2vw, 1.35rem);
    line-height: 1.35;
}

@media (max-width: 920px) {
    .exportaciones-giro__card {
        flex-basis: 100%;
    }
}
